Halifax RSPCA calls on all to join fitness fundraising challenge

The RSPCA Halifax, Huddersfield, Bradford and District Branch are calling on supporters to take on their Best Paw Forward Challenge.

For those who want to get back into shape or would like to set themselves a personal goal, this challenge involves completing 26.2 miles throughout the month of June by either running, walking or cycling at your own pace.

To motivate and add some competition to your challenge, the branch also encourages getting family and friends to sponsor you to raise much needed funds for the animals currently in their centre during the Covid-19 pandemic.

Community Fundraiser Michelle King said: “We’re really excited to be launching this brand-new challenge where people of any fitness level or capability can take part - I’ll even be taking on the challenge myself! It’s a great way to get active and also support and raise funds for the animals who have been with us during Lockdown’’

All participants who raise over £20 in sponsorship will receive an official medal for their achievement and can easily set up their own fundraising page on JustGiving or get in touch with the Branch for a sponsor form.

The challenge has already had its first participant in the form of Max – one of the current residents at the Animal Centre who will be putting his best Paw Forward to cover the 26.2 miles on his daily walks over the next month.
